How is SUI coin different from other cryptocurrencies? Sui distinguishes itself through a combination of architectural choices, technological innovations, and a focus on specific use cases within the crypto ecosystem. Many blockchains struggle with scalability and speed, leading to high transaction fees and slow confirmation times. Sui addresses these challenges directly.
Unlike many other blockchains relying on older architectures, Sui employs a novel data structure and a unique consensus mechanism designed for high throughput and low latency. This means that transactions are processed much faster and more efficiently, making it ideal for applications demanding real-time interactions, like metaverse experiences and NFT marketplaces. This speed advantage significantly improves the user experience.
Many cryptocurrencies are built on general-purpose platforms. Sui, however, is explicitly designed with a focus on the metaverse and NFTs. This targeted approach allows for optimization of features specifically beneficial to these burgeoning sectors. The platform incorporates features specifically designed to handle the complexities of digital assets and in-game economies, making it a more attractive option for developers building within these spaces.
The programming language and development tools available for Sui are another key differentiator. Sui offers a developer-friendly environment, potentially attracting a broader range of developers. This ecosystem fosters innovation and allows for quicker development cycles, accelerating the growth of the Sui network and its applications. Ease of development can also lead to a more diverse range of applications built on the platform.
Governance is a critical aspect differentiating Sui from other cryptocurrencies. Sui's governance model, while still evolving, is designed to encourage community participation and decision-making. This approach, contrasting with more centralized models, aims to create a more democratic and transparent ecosystem. The specifics of its governance token distribution and voting mechanisms will influence its long-term evolution.
The consensus mechanism employed by Sui is also a crucial distinction. While many blockchains use Proof-of-Work or Proof-of-Stake, Sui utilizes a different mechanism. The details of Sui's consensus mechanism impact its energy efficiency, security, and transaction speeds. A more efficient mechanism could lead to lower costs and a smaller environmental footprint.
The design philosophy behind Sui centers around creating a platform that is both scalable and developer-friendly. This focus aims to overcome some of the limitations encountered in other blockchains. The combination of speed, scalability, and developer-centric tools makes Sui a unique contender in the cryptocurrency landscape.
Sui's emphasis on NFTs sets it apart. Many blockchains support NFTs, but Sui's architecture is specifically optimized for their efficient creation, transfer, and management. This optimization can lead to lower transaction fees and faster processing times for NFT transactions, a crucial aspect for NFT marketplaces and metaverse applications.
Another distinguishing factor is Sui's object-based programming model. This contrasts with account-based models found in many other cryptocurrencies. This different approach impacts how data is stored and managed on the blockchain, potentially offering advantages in terms of scalability and performance.
Sui's focus on providing a secure environment for digital assets is paramount. Robust security measures are incorporated into the platform’s design to protect user funds and assets. The specifics of these measures, including cryptography and consensus mechanisms, contribute to Sui's overall security profile.
Sui's ecosystem is still relatively young, meaning its future trajectory and capabilities are still evolving. This presents both opportunities and uncertainties. The level of community engagement and developer adoption will be crucial in shaping Sui's long-term success.
